Teams: Arsenal v Man City: Wenger sticks with 3-4-3
Arsenal will be desperate to book our place in the FA Cup final when we take on Manchester City at Wembley this afternoon.
Arsene Wenger has named an unchanged line-up which means we’re sticking with the 3-4-3 formation that we used during the win at Middlesbrough last week.
Here are the teams:
Arsenal
Cech; Gabriel, Koscielny, Holding; Oxlade-Chamberlain, Ramsey, Xhaka, Monreal; Özil, Sanchez; Giroud.
Subs: Martinez, Bellerin, Gibbs, Coquelin, Walcott, Iwobi, Welbeck
Man City
Bravo, Navas, Kompany, Otamendi, Clichy, Fernandinho, Toure, De Bruyne, Silva, Sane, Aguero
Subs: Caballero, Zabaleta, Fernando, Sterling, Kolarov, Delph, Iheanacho
